Instructions
 

  • To a saucepan and on medium-high heat, add boiled water, salt, and extra virgin olive oil.
  • Add pasta to boiling water. Cook according to package instructions.
  • Test with a fork and reduce heat once cooked.
  • Strain and cool. Add back to the pan and serve.

How Long Does Cooked Spaghetti Last?

MethodDuration
Fridge3 to 5 days.
Freezer3 months.
